Nepal is one of the world's leading trekking
destinations, attracting more than 400,000
foreign tourists each year. However, very
few rural people benefit from this business.
Uncontrolled tourism has damaged the
environment and induced unwanted social
change along Nepal's most popular trekking
routes.
Community Tourism is
different. It is an income-generating
activity, operated by rural communities, and
is an integral part of multifaceted
approach to the alleviation of poverty.
CCODER's innovative tourism program
enhances inter-cultural relationships while
offering economic development to the
disadvantaged in remote village areas.
Community Tourism is interlinked with all
other components of CCODER's village
development model. The banks, the schools
and the families are all part of this unique
trekking alternative!
Community Tourism : Sharing the Benefits
With the Communities
The Community Tourism Program, which
started in 1998, links community development
and sustainable tourism by creating
employment and local marketing possibilities
for local products,
thus generating income for villagers. Women
are major beneficiaries, as tourism creates
many new job opportunities for them.
Wherever possible, we employ local
staff, buy local products, and offer
village 'home stay' accommodation – not only
to give you, the tourist, a very unique
holiday experience, but also to maximize the
benefits from tourism for the host
communities!
Community Tourism is a rural enterprise
owned and operated by the local people. It
is a group activity, and benefits are shared
among as many villages and individuals as
possible. CCODER assists the communities in
the development of tourism products,
training, infrastructure improvements,
networking and marketing and promotion.
Community Tourism provides incentives for
reforestation and nature conservation.
Village home-stays also encourage
intercultural exchange, mutual
understanding, and learning, all of which
foster the sense of a 'global family.'
Our Effort:
We work for and with rural people and help them
to develop their resources and skills.
Up to now, our activities have included the
selection and development of model tourism villages,
development of trekking routes, preparation
of guestrooms, numbering of houses,
infrastructure improvements (drinking water,
trail improvement etc.), trainings (tourism
awareness, hygienic food preparation,
hospitality management, community-based
planning) promotion, marketing and
linking tourists to the communities.
